Software Engineer - Data Engineering
Akuna Capital
about 2 months ago
Chicago, IL, USA
Mid Level / Senior
H1B Sponsor
Base Salary
$130k - $130k/yr
Responsibilities
- Support the strategic role of data within the growing Data Engineering division.
- Design and expand the data platform across various data sources.
- Collaborate with Trading, Quant, Technology, and Business Operations teams to define and deliver impactful projects.
- Build and deploy batch and streaming pipelines for Big Data within a hybrid cloud architecture.
- Mentor junior engineers in software and data engineering best practices.
- Produce clean, well-tested, and documented code for mission-critical applications.
- Build automated data validation test suites to ensure compliance with SLAs.
- Challenge existing processes to enhance the tech stack.
Requirements
- BS/MS/PhD in Computer Science, Engineering, Physics, Math, or a related field.
- 5+ years of professional experience in software application development.
- Proficiency in Java/Scala; Python experience is a plus.
- Hands-on experience with data platforms and technologies like Delta Lake, Spark, and Kubernetes.
- Experience in building large-scale batch and streaming pipelines with strict SLA requirements.
- Excellent communication, analytical, and problem-solving skills.
- Experience with diverse data sets across multiple domains; financial data experience is a plus.
- Recent hands-on experience with AWS Cloud development and monitoring.
- Experience working on an Agile team with software engineering best practices.
Benefits
- Comprehensive benefits package including employer-paid medical, dental, and vision.
- Retirement contributions and paid time off.
- Discretionary performance bonus as part of the total compensation package.
Tech Stack
Apache KafkaApache SparkAWSClickHouseJavaKubernetesPrestoPythonScala
Categories
Data Engineering